Table 3.

Comparison of the Removal of Iron and Porphyrin Accumulation in the Liver Induced by Hydroxypyridinone Chelators

TreatmentNonheme Iron (μg/g liver)FerritinFerritin Iron (μg/g liver)Ferrochelatase Activity (nmol/h/mg)Protoporphyrin (nmol/g liver)
(% of control)
Control 55 ± 5 100 ± 27 6.8 ± 1.4 12.9 ± 3.9 0.4 ± 0.1 
CP20 33 ± 13-150 72 ± 153-150 1.8 ± 0.33-150 8.2 ± 3.9 3.2 ± 3.9 
CP94 36 ± 23-150 68 ± 103-150 2.1 ± 0.23-150 8.1 ± 1.73-150 17.1 ± 15.93-150 
CP102 44 ± 73-150 78 ± 223-150 2.9 ± 0.63-150 14.9 ± 5.1 0.3 ± 0.1 
CP117 36 ± 23-150 60 ± 73-150 3.1 ± 0.83-150 ND 0.6 ± 0.1

C57BL/10 ScSn mice received CP20, CP94, and CP102 in the drinking water at 2 mg/mL and CP117 at 3 mg/mL for 2 weeks. Values are the means of 5 mice per group.

Abbreviation: ND, not determined.

F3-150

Significantly different from control, P < .05.
